Job description

STYLIST


WHAT WE OFFER

Are you looking for a place where you can change people's lives? You've come to the right place. A haircut is not just a haircut with us, it's an experience, whether you're giving a client a haircut, color and highlights, waxing or one of our specialty services. It's your skill matched with our proprietary tools and techniques that will set you up for success.


WHAT YOU'LL DO

You'll provide exceptional guest service, understand your guest's needs, providing quality consultations and performing services requested in an efficient and professional manner.#UnleashYourPotential


WE'D LOVE TO HEAR FROM YOU IF YOU MEET THESE QUALIFICATIONS

  • You have a current cosmetology or barber license as required by state/provincial regulations.
  • You can and want to work a flexible schedule, including evenings and weekends.
  • You are tech savvy and can perform administrative tasks. You may be closing out the system at the end of the day.
  • You need to know how to read, write, and do basic math.


P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

  • You need good eyesight to observe a guest's hair, including close vision, color vision and ability to adjust focus.
  • If you enjoy moving around and staying active you can do that here. You'll be standing, lifting, and reaching for the stars. You need to be comfortable with lifting, bending, and performing repetitive movements, occasionally lifting 10-25 lbs.
  • We use chemicals and fragrances in our treatments which you will smell. You must be ok with fragrances and chemicals.


Compensation

  • We operate on a commission structure for both services and retail product sales.
  • The commission plan ranges from a starting of 45% to upwards of 60%.
  • In addition, you keep all your tips as well.
  • We also protect you from those times where business is a bit slower by guaranteeing a minimum hourly base wage on top of your tips.
  • There is also potential to earn monthly bonuses.
